In Commander, Spiritmonger occupies an awkward middle tier — it's a resilient, self-protecting beater, but five mana for a creature that doesn't immediately affect the board is a hard sell when the format demands more explosive payoffs. Legacy is the format where Spiritmonger had its moment: the regeneration and color-shifting made it genuinely difficult to kill with the removal suites of its era, though contemporary Legacy threats have long outpaced it. Vintage and Oathbreaker are both legal formats, but neither has any real use for a five-mana vanilla-adjacent creature when the power ceiling is so much higher.

At $2.05, Spiritmonger sits firmly in the bulk-rare tier — nostalgic enough to hold a floor, not powerful enough to climb. That price reflects casual and Commander demand from players who remember it fondly; don't expect it to move in either direction.
